Merger with American Water Works
Adding to the mix of recent events, Essential Utilities is merging with American Water Works Company, Inc. This significant transaction is valued at around $63 billion, including debt. This all-stock deal allows Essential shareholders to receive 0.305 shares of American Water for each share they own. Post-merger, American Water shareholders will control about 69% of the combined entity, while Essential shareholders will own approximately 31%.
The merger aims to enhance service offerings and operational efficiencies, creating a stronger entity in the utilities sector. Legal Investigations Underway
While the merger is seen as a positive move for the company’s growth, it has also attracted scrutiny. Legal investigations by Ademi Firm and Halper Sadeh LLC are currently underway. These investigations focus on potential breaches of fiduciary duty and the fairness of the sale terms for Essential shareholders.
The concerns raised include substantial benefits for Essential insiders and a penalty clause that may limit competing offers. Halper Sadeh LLC is urging Essential shareholders to act quickly to protect their interests, reflecting the critical nature of these investigations.
